I started a load workup with Montana Gold 124gr JHP and even though I found a load which is quite clean, I was playing with the numbers in Quickload using a Speer 124gr bullet for the data.  According to QL, I'm approaching maximum pressure (but still below max) using 4.6 grains of VV N-340.  I modified the BA numbers to get the velocity to match what I'm chronoing at (1065 fps) at a COAL of 1.080.  VV load booklet shows 4.9 grains being the max load using Lapua's megashock bullet which is the only one listed in that weight range and N-340.

 

My previous loads using Zero Bullets 124 JHP were pushing 1190-1200 fps out of my Glock 19 at 5.5 grains.  (.6 over max, but no pressure signs) yet quite dirty.

 

I'm now running magnum small pistol primers, and found that my lower load, even though slower and less pressure, is almost clinically-clean using same powder and same weight-class bullet.

 

I wanted to play around with N-310, and looking at Quickload to get me in the ballpark since I have over 20 pounds of it, so wanted to get the data a bit more accurate by seeing if anyone had generated a .bul file for Montana Gold, as I can't find it anywhere.

 

Has anyone run N-310 with 9mm?  I know it's supposed to be bunny-fart soft with heavy projectiles in .45 ACP.  N-320 seems better suited for 9mm, but only have about 2 pounds of that left.

 

Anyhow, have 4k to load, and I'll do half with this current load and try out N-310 once I finish this first batch.  Recoil is kinda snappy in the Glock, even though I'm running a comp on it, there is no gas to drive it.  I'm getting a full burn though.
